Er
Definitions
- 1 Said when hesitating in speech. informal
"“Er...Feathered Omen, hoot not,” he continued uneasily, “Son of Tanit, hoot not!”"
- 1 A surname. countable, uncountable
- 2 Initialism of Elizabeth Regina (“Queen Elizabeth”). abbreviation, alt-of, initialism
- 3 Initialism of Edward Rex (on coins, letterboxes, etc.) The royal cypher for Edward VII, king of Great Britain British, abbreviation, alt-of, initialism
- 4 Initialism of Eleanor Roosevelt. US, abbreviation, alt-of, initialism
- 5 Abbreviation of Erie (“Erie, Pennsylvania, USA”). US, abbreviation, alt-of
- 1 An occurrence of the interjection "er".
"Although Shakespeare refers to “hums and ha’s,” sifting through etiquette manuals and public-speaking guides turns up scant evidence of a prohibition against ums, ers and uhs, which are profuse in the first recording of Thomas Edison’s voice, in 1888. Mr. Erard, rather ingeniously, traces the prohibition on um and other speech flaws to the advent of radio in the early 1920s."
- 2 The name of the Cyrillic script letter Р / р.
